BMT 201 - Introduction to ERP

Hours: 3
The course provides an overview of Enterprise Resource Planning software systems and their role within an organization. It introduces key concepts integrated information systems and explains why such systems are valuable to businesses. In addition to lecture, students will be guided through several hands-on activities of various business processes in SAP R/3 software product. The course will also provide a discussion on various business cases in which ERP concepts can be applied.

Prerequisite: CIS 101 , CIS 110 ,or CIS 121  with a minimum grade of C
